Transaction 4c38a52920c8a9c89ae30452824a31f2faae4d51af2d303ce7314513a4c79c13

1 Input
2 Outputs
  • 4c38a52920c8a9c89ae30452824a31f2faae4d51af2d303ce7314513a4c79c13:0
  • value  21600
    address  3FdBFuVRSdurgcjD8aWiqAgokZGajw3CFW
  • 4c38a52920c8a9c89ae30452824a31f2faae4d51af2d303ce7314513a4c79c13:1
  • value  854362
    address  113p5EBvuEgyp7BbAJX3tJiPfyhGTGTD3m